The Breeding Programme of Peach Rootstocks at the Fruit Research Station in Constanta had two phases: Phase 1978-1983. This included some initial objectives which were immediately met: a) prospecting native and cultivated tree flora from the area, taking into account some rootstock selections well adapted to local specific conditions; and b) introduction of the valuable rootstocks, as well as the species used world-wide, for increasing the hereditary base. This resulted in the establishment of a germplasm collection necessary for the creation of new rootstocks. The study of genitor (parental) characters was made in this collection with a view of to finding the best genitors. Phase 1983-2002: the objectives, methods, and genetic and material base for a complex programme of genetic breeding were established. Following these studies, genitors for different characters were established and new rootstocks were created by self-pollination, intra- and inter-specific hybridisations. Up until the present time, breeding work in Constanta has produced over 3500 hybrids of F1, C1, and F2 generations.
